Gas dryer. won't heat. replaced ignitor sensor. still won't heat. seems that a valve is stuck closed (auto-valve), which is it? hold or ass't ?

The glow igniter should light up and after a delay the sensor will click and turn on the gas valve. If the gas doesn't flow and light the cycle will repeat.

Most likely you need a gas valve coil kit. The coils get weak and wont open the gas valve.

My Kenmore 60 series gas dryer will not heat up. I checked the lint trap and it is clean. How do I open the front panel to check the pilot light?

Some dryers have a small inspection hole covered by a small platic cap.
Remove cap and look inside unit for pilot. Newer dryers have an igniter that glows when the dryer is turned on. It ignites the gas then goes out.
